Spartans’ Attack Strong Against WolfPack
TWU wins second match of Canada West play over TRU

LANGLEY, British Columbia – Backed by the strong overall play of Rhonda Schmuland (5th year, Calgary, middle, AB)  with one ace, five kills and four blocks, TWU (2-0) earned their second victory in the young season in straight sets (25-18, 25-16, 25-14) over Thompson Rivers University(1-5). The Spartans defense and serving proved to be too much for the WolfPack to handle. TWU finished the match with ten team blocks and nine aces, while TRU finished with two team blocks and three aces.

The Spartans started first set strong jumping out to a commanding 8-2 lead by the first timeout. However, TRU fought hard to get back into the match and closed the gap to four points by the second timeout with the Spartans up 16-12. Trinity Western proved to be too much for Thompson Rivers in the first set finishing out the first set 25-18. Leigh Dreher (1st year, Prince George, leftside, BC) was the dominant player in the set having six kills and one block in the set.

In the second set TW started quickly again and had an 8-3 lead going into the first timeout. The Spartans piled on the points, stretching their lead to 16-7 at the second timeout. From that point on the Spartans cruised to victory, 25-16. Team defense was great for TWU as they had four blocks total in the set and held TRU to a 0% hitting average.

The third set started close but TWU was ahead once again at the first timeout 8-6. After time out TWU came out flying. The Spartans essentially finished of the WolfPack by going on a 8-2 run to increase their lead to 16-8 at the second timeout. TWU never looked back finishing out the final set 25-14.

Leigh Dreher had the top hitting performance as she hit 44% and had a total of nine kills, and Anna Paddock (4th year, Portland, setter, ME) had a great serving match as she had three aces.

Trinity Western now heads off to Simon Fraser next weekend for two matches against the Clan. Matches are on Sunday, November 13 at 4 pm and Monday, November 14 at 7 pm.

Match Notes: Trinity Western hit 26% while TRU hit at 4%... TWU had 10 total blocks to the WolfPack’s two... Robyn Devlin (Revelstoke, BC) had eight kills for TRU.
